Knowles Acoustics
Founded in 1946, Knowles Electronics is the leading global supplier of advanced micro-acoustic and human interface solutions, including hearing aid components, MEMS microphones as well as dynamic speakers and recievers. Providing unique technology expertise and a broad product portfolio, Knowles serves the markets for hearing health, mobile communications, consumer electronics, military communications and professional audio. Headquartered in Itasca, USA, Knowles had more than 6,000 employees in 16 locations worldwide. For more information visit the Knowles website at www.knowles.com. Knowles is owned by the Dover Corporation, a multi-billion dollar diversified producer of innovative equipemnt, speciality systems and value-added services.
